November is Diabetes Awareness Month

During the month of November, Special Olympics Pennsylvania (SOPA) is recognizing Diabetes Awareness Month by helping athletes learn about and prevent diabetes melitus (DM). DM is one of the most common diseases among Americans and affects those with intellectual disability at a much greater rate. 2022 PHLY Insurance Valor Award Winner: Logan Wismer

Each year during Fall Festival, the Philadelphia Insurance Companies Valor Award is given to an athlete whose effort, determination and sportsmanship embodies the power of the human spirit to overcome challenges and inspire greatness.
